How can you tell if a linear system has infinitely many solutions? Include how you tell graphically and algebraically when solving. 

The equations are the same, the graphed lines lie on top of one another, or solving the system provides a true statement with no variables.

When will a system of linear equations have no solution? Include how you tell graphically and algebraically when solving. 

The lines are parallel or they have the same slope and different y-intercepts or when you solve the equations and get a false statement with no variables remaining.

How does the graphing method for solving a system of linear equations work?

Graph the two lines. The solution is the point(s) of intersection.
